10 Beat your plowshares into swords
    and your pruning hooks(A) into spears.(B)
Let the weakling(C) say,
    “I am strong!”(D)
11 Come quickly, all you nations from every side,
    and assemble(E) there.

Bring down your warriors,(F) Lord!

12 “Let the nations be roused;
    let them advance into the Valley of Jehoshaphat,(G)
for there I will sit
    to judge(H) all the nations on every side.
